Industrial-Grade Cutting Technology
The biggest lawn mowers leverage advanced cutting decks and high-torque propulsion to handle dense grass, brush, and uneven ground. Hydrostatic transmissions enable smooth speed control without complex gear changes, which is essential for operators managing large areas.
Reel mowers with precision grinding produce clean cuts on premium turf, while rotary and flail mowers excel at clearing tall, coarse vegetation. Durability is prioritized through reinforced frames, hardened blades, and advanced cooling systems for continuous operation.
Power, Fuel Efficiency, and Engine Options
Engine selection defines performance boundaries for the biggest lawn mowers. Diesel power plants offer high torque and fuel efficiency, making them ideal for heavy-duty, all-day schedules. Alternatively, gasoline engines provide quicker startup and lighter weight in certain configurations.
Hybrid and alternative-fuel prototypes are emerging, targeting reduced emissions and operational costs. Cooling package design, air filtration, and after-treatment systems are tailored to meet environmental regulations while sustaining peak output.
Attachments, Comfort, and Operator Efficiency
Productivity on large sites increases when mowers integrate seamlessly with attachments such as mulching kits, aeration frames, and snow blades. Operator comfort features like adjustable seating, climate control, and vibration reduction reduce fatigue and errors over long shifts.
Telematics and GPS guidance help map routes, monitor uptime, and optimize fuel usage. Quick-access service panels and modular components shorten maintenance windows, keeping the biggest lawn mowers productive during peak seasons.

Buying Criteria and Long-Term Value
Selecting among the biggest lawn mowers extends beyond raw specs. Initial price, maintenance intervals, parts availability, and resale value shape the total cost of ownership over years of demanding use.
Fuel efficiency, expected annual operating hours, and local climate conditions influence return on investment. Leasing and equipment financing options can align cash flow with seasonal revenue patterns for large-scale operations.

How do reel mowers compare to rotary mowers for large turf areas?
Reel mowers deliver superior cut quality on premium turf such as golf greens, while rotary mowers handle rough, tall vegetation more robustly; choice depends on turf standards and terrain.
What fuel and operational considerations apply to the biggest lawn mowers?
Diesel fuel is common for heavy-duty models due to efficiency and torque, whereas gasoline options suit lighter or shorter-shift applications; runtime, refueling logistics, and emissions rules all factor into planning.
What maintenance practices maximize uptime for large commercial mowers?
Regular blade sharpening, timely filter changes, hydraulic system checks, and telematics-driven service scheduling minimize downtime and extend equipment life in demanding environments.
